When Black people rise, we all rise.

Inspired by the necessity to reverse the systemic failures that led to the death of Breonna Taylor, the 3003 Project works to build a Kentucky where Black people thrive.

Race4Justice: community honors Breonna Taylor with Future Ancestors 03/31/2025

Race4Justice: community honors Breonna Taylor with Future Ancestors The main highlight of the event was preparing for the fourth annual Race4Justice. The race will feature 26 laps, each symbolizing a year lived by Breonna Taylor.
